Chicken Couscous

Moroccan couscous transforms humble grains into something substantial through the alchemy of spiced broth and slow-cooked chicken. The harissa brings heat that blooms across your palate, while dried apricots add unexpected sweetness that balances the spice, a technique central to Moroccan cooking. This dish proves why couscous pairs so naturally with North African flavors: it absorbs every nuance of the sauce around it, becoming far more than a side.
Instructions
Heat the olive oil in a large frying pan and cook the onion for 1-2 mins just until softened.
Add the chicken and fry for 7-10 mins until cooked through and the onions have turned golden.
Grate over the ginger, stir through the harissa to coat everything and cook for 1 min more.
Tip in the apricots, chickpeas and couscous, then pour over the stock and stir once.
Cover with a lid or tightly cover the pan with foil and leave for about 5 mins until the couscous has soaked up all the stock and is soft.
Fluff up the couscous with a fork and scatter over the coriander to serve.
Serve with extra harissa, if you like..
